YOUNG ADULT ACCESS CENTERS
Vinfen’s Enhanced Young Adult Program (EYAP) provides access centers in Lawrence, Lowell, and Everett to help young people embark on a positive life path into adulthood and toward the goals of personal stability, secure housing, competitive employment, and positive family and social relationships.
Access centers offer low-barrier services and support to young adults, ages 16-26. Young adults can receive support for housing, education, attend events, and access support for managing their mental health without the need for a referral. We offer ‘Drop-In’ centers and person-centered supports that are tailored to the individual’s needs and goals that they identify.
Most of your youth services are available to young adults between the ages of 14-25 who are eligible to receive support from the Massachusetts Department of Mental Health. However, our youth and young adult access centers, YouForward and YouthQuake, are self-referral and open to anyone between the ages of 14-25 having difficulty regulating their emotions or facing substance use or mental health challenges.
